WebJul 12, 2024 · Answer. In addition to the Pythagorean Identity, it is often necessary to rewrite the tangent, secant, cosecant, and cotangent as part of solving an equation. Example 7.1. 4. Solve tan ( x) = 3 sin ( x) for all solutions with 0 ≤ x < 2 π. Solution. With a combination of tangent and sine, we might try rewriting tangent. The easiest way is to see that cos 2φ = cos²φ - sin²φ = 2 cos²φ - 1 or 1 - 2sin²φ by the cosine double angle formula and the Pythagorean identity. Now substitute 2φ = θ into those last two equations and solve for sin θ/2 and cos θ/2.
